How much does a College Professor - Foreign Languages make in Fort Wayne, IN? The average College Professor - Foreign Languages salary in Fort Wayne, IN is $103,600 as of May 28, 2024, but the range typically falls between $79,100 and $154,600.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Percentile | Salary | Location | Last Updated |
10th Percentile College Professor - Foreign Languages Salary | $56,794 | Fort Wayne,IN | May 28, 2024 |
25th Percentile College Professor - Foreign Languages Salary | $79,100 | Fort Wayne,IN | May 28, 2024 |
50th Percentile College Professor - Foreign Languages Salary | $103,600 | Fort Wayne,IN | May 28, 2024 |
75th Percentile College Professor - Foreign Languages Salary | $154,600 | Fort Wayne,IN | May 28, 2024 |
90th Percentile College Professor - Foreign Languages Salary | $201,033 | Fort Wayne,IN | May 28, 2024 |

The College Professor - Foreign Languages develops and designs curriculum plans to foster student learning, stimulate class discussions, and ensures student engagement. Teaches courses in the discipline area of foreign languages. Being a College Professor - Foreign Languages collaborates and supports colleagues regarding research interests and co-curricular activities. Provides tutoring and academic counseling to students, maintains classes related records, and assesses student coursework. In addition, College Professor - Foreign Languages typically reports to a department head. Requires a PhD or terminal degree appropriate to the field. Has considerable experience and is qualified to teach at undergraduate and graduate levels and initiates research and case studies in field of interest and may publish findings in trade journals or textbooks. Provides intellectual leadership and has made significant contributions to the field. May offer independent study opportunities and mentoring to students. Typically this individual is a leader in the field and has been published.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
